Spleen 16 July 2001. Between "The Birds" and "Frenzy" Hitchcock made three consecutive critical and box office failures: "Marnie (1964), "Torn Curtain" (1966), and "Topaz" (1969). It's natural to want to rehabilitate one or other of these, and most fans and critics, following (of course) François Truffaut, pick "Marnie".
Torn Curtain: Directed by Alfred Hitchcock. With Paul Newman, Julie Andrews, Lila Kedrova, Hansjörg Felmy. An American scientist publicly defects to East Germany as part of a cloak and dagger mission to find the solution for a formula resin before planning an escape back to the West.

Torn Curtain was released without any rating on 14 July 1966 (see original 1966 movie poster above). However, the film was given an "R" (for "Restricted") under the MPAA film rating system that took effect November 1, 1968. It was ultimately re-rated PG in 1984.
